About Us
RAM Partners, LLC, is a full-service real estate management company that manages more than 80 apartments throughout the United States.

We specialize in multi-family community management for a variety of third-party owners.

We are a service-oriented, hands-on company.

Our brick and mortar are our people.

Overview

We are looking for a Maintenance Tech who will use their maintenance experience and attention to detail skills to maintain the physical integrity of our property.

Responsibilities
  • Complete work orders promptly based on priority.
  • Complete make-readies.
  • Maintain property grounds and common areas.
  • Perform preventative maintenance.
  • Keep a clean and organized shop and work areas.
  • Provide parts and materials list weekly.
  • Assist in emergency coverage with team members.
  • Demonstrate professional customer service to residents, staff, and vendors.
  • Follow all safety policies and procedures.
  • Perform other duties as assigned by the manager.
Qualifications
  • High School Diploma or equivalent; college degree is a plus.
  • Valid Driver's license.
  • EPA HVAC certification preferred.
  • Excellent communication skills.
  • Basic computer skills in Microsoft Office.
  • Ability to multitask and meet deadlines.
  • Willing to work flexible hours, including weekends.
